About Tom Kereszti

I'm Tom Kereszti, and my friends call me a Culture Catalyst. My mission? To help international C-suite executives create healthy company cultures that not only resonate today but also build the future leaders of tomorrow. In an age where organizational culture is paramount, I believe in empowering self-led teams and nurturing future leaders who can drive sustainable growth and profitability. I mentor leaders and their teams through the principles of honesty, integrity, trust, love, and empowerment—all grounded in Biblical values and exemplified by the Navy SEALs. My journey has been anything but ordinary. As the CEO of a $400M global company, I’ve navigated the complexities of international business, restructuring non-profitable companies into thriving entities and leading global acquisition projects in Brazil, Europe and Middle East. I've held pivotal roles, directing a $1B merger and managing $100M companies in Central America and Eastern Europe.With a rich tapestry of experiences through industry giants like Colgate Palmolive, Philips, ReckittBenckiser and the Strauss Group, I've come to realize that successful businesses flourish when their cultures are robust and their teams cohesive. This taught me how to lead effectively across borders and cultures, facilitating my success in building and mentoring high-performing executive teams. An essential part of my own growth was my education. I earned my Engineering from NYU and an MBA from PACE. I further honed my leadership skills through programs like the Wharton Fellows and Harvard Business School Executive Education. Today, I'm also proud to be a Maxwell Certified Coach, Speaker, and Trainer, as well as a DISC Certified Consultant. Now, I am an industry influencer, author, speaker, advisor, and mentor. My focus is on serving C-suite executives of mid to large companies through tailored advisory and consulting services. I captured my international business and life experiences through my book, C-Suite and Beyond, crafted from the lessons learned throughout my dynamic career. My book is integral to conducting leadership workshops for young leaders eager to evolve into executive leaders, along with culture workshops that enable self-led teams to flourish. I even integrate AI tools to benchmark and elevate leadership and company culture, providing actionable insights.I'm here to ignite transformation in corporate culture. 2004 - 2016 ~12 yrs

Ceo | International Markets

Petach Tikva, Il

Based in Israel, this $1B FMCG foods company controlled by the Strauss family has JV’s with Danone, Unilever & Pepsi.As CEO of Elite International located in the Netherlands, created a vision and developed strategic business plan for all international operations of the StraussElite group. Elite International is a leading branded coffee & coffee related products and services company primarily in the emerging markets of Central & Eastern Europe and Latin America. Achieved +20% compounded annual sales growth to $250M+ through product development and an exclusive distribution alliance with LAVAZZA. Restructured the company and established an international management team to implement best practices in the FMCG industry eliminating -$1M in operating losses. Implemented company wide people mentoring / training for 2000+ employees across commercial & manufacturing operations in 12+ countries.KEY ACCOMPLISHMENTS:Established global alliances, market & business development.• Negotiated, acquired, merged companies. Formed joint ventures.• Created Brands through market research, consumer insight and product development.• Restructured stagnating non-profitable companies to lucrative status.• Led successful startup of new companies.• Mentored people development, training, and team building.• Achieved consumer & trade product preference through sales & marketing. • Managed relationships among board, investors and stake holders.• Planned, budgeted, and controlled regional & country business activities.• Demonstrated P&L responsibility in competitive and high growth market environments.• Adopted business technology and acted as an internal company consultant. • Led successful global corporate initiatives.

Vp | Global Business Improvements

Slough, Berkshire, Gb

Through the global merger of Reckitt&Colman and Benckiser, ReckittBenckiser is Fortune 500 and the world’s largest household cleaning company, operates in 100+ countries and is leader in several niche product categories. Director – Global Business Improvements – Corporate HQ UKReporting to the CEO & EVP of Information Systems, managed the $5+B global merger process of ReckittBenckiser enabling independent professional teams to establish new business processes in commercial, operational & back office competencies. Identified technologies to track merger synergies, merger costs and growth opportunities. Established processes to capture new business models aligned with the merged companies needs. Benchmarked global business processes to world class standards & integrated improvements. Piloted new technology to support new business processes. Identified internal process needs to meet B2B & B2C e-business opportunities.

1996 - 2001 ~5 yrs

General Manager | New Markets

Slough, Berkshire, Gb

Benckiser is a top 10 global household cleaning company, operating in Europe and North America and is a leader in several niche product categories. General Manager - Mexico Reporting to the V.P. of Americas, led Benckiser’s first Latin American and first new market entry as a public company. Developed a 5 year strategic business plan with expected revenues of over $100M. Established the best selling premium cleaner in Mexico, with leading share of voice in TV media. Identified acquisition candidate & led initial due diligence for board approval. Developed world wide fabric softener strategies as a key member of the Global Marketing Team.

1998 - 1999 ~1 yr

General Manager | Emerging Markets

Slough, Berkshire, Gb

Through the global merger of Reckitt&Colman and Benckiser, ReckittBenckiser is the world’s largest household cleaning company, operates in 100+ countries and is leader in several niche product categories. General Manager - Czech & Slovak Republics Reporting to the V.P. of Eastern Europe, turned around Benckiser’s stagnating and non-profitable local subsidiary to lucrative status. Generated cumulative net sales growth of 135% to over $40m and profit growth of +200% while reducing net working capital by 4% and minimized exposure of multiple currencies.. Reversed declining market shares in mature market segments and achieved market dominance in specialty high profit product categories. Developed the local team of 100+, eventually promoting 5 managers to international positions. Defined regional strategies as member of the Eastern European Management Team.

1996 - 1998 ~2 yrs

General Manager | Consumer Products

Amsterdam, Noord-Holland, Nl

PHILIPS ELECTRONICS COMPANYRoyal Philips Electronics is eighth on Fortune's list of global top 30 electronics corporations. Philips is active in about 60 businesses, varying from consumer electronics to domestic appliances, and from security systems to semiconductors.General Manager - Consumer Products - Hungary Reporting to the CEO of Philips Hungary, restructured and aligned with the local market, the consumer electronics & domestic appliances division of Philips Electronics Hungarian subsidiary. Attained market leadership in numerous market segments resulting in year on year net sales growth of 161%.

1994 - 1996 ~2 yrs

General Management

New York, New York, Us

COLGATE PALMOLIVE COMPANYColgate-Palmolive is a Fortune 500 consumer products powerhouse, operates in over 200 world markets and is leader in Oral Care, Personal Care, Household Surface Care, Fabric Care and Pet Nutrition categories.Deputy General Manager - HungaryLed successful startup of a new company in Hungary, Colgate Palmolive's lead country in the Eastern European Division. In three years, attained leadership shares in selected segments of the oral, body and surface cleaning categories and achieve sales growth from a zero base to $12+M. Identified and acquired the local Fabulon company, to position Colgate Palmolive as the number 2 body care company in Hungary. Corporate & Subsidiary Management Positions – USAVarious managerial positions of increasing responsibility in all critical commercial and operational competencies with strategic and tactical implications. Located in New York corporate headquarters & different geographies.
